OGEMA ELEMENTARY SCHOOL
Ogema Elementary is a Title I public elementary school that is part of the Prentice School District school district, located in Ogema, WI with about 40 students offering grade levels from Pre-Kindergarten to 3rd Grade. A Title I school provides supplemental financial assistance to school districts for children from low-income families. Its purpose is to provide all children significant opportunity to receive a fair, equitable, and high-quality education. With about 6 teachers, Ogema Elementary has a student/teacher ratio of about 6:1. The national average for public schools is about 15:1. A lower student/teacher ratio is a key factor that determines how much a teacher can devote his/her time to each individual student thus improving, or reducing (in the event of a higher student/teacher ratio) the attention each student is given for their educational needs.

School Demographics for 40 students
The primary ethnicity of students attending OGEMA ELEMENTARY SCHOOL is predominantly White, representing about 95% of the student body.
- White
- 95.0%
- American Indian or Alaska Native
- 2.5%
- Two or more races
- 2.5%
- Female
- 57.5%
- Male
- 42.5%
